### Runbook: Report export timezone mismatches (Glimmerfield)

If a customer reports that exported totals differ from the dashboard, check whether their report schedule predates the March cutover — older schedules still render in server-local time rather than the account timezone. Re-saving the schedule fixes it. Before escalating, confirm the export worker is running with the expected timezone settings shown below.

config for kadup-kajog:
[raldor]
host = raldor.tolvaqworks.internal
user = raldor_svc
database = raldor_prod

First-day checklist — Item 4: Secure interview room. Show the new starter Room 3.14 at Ashgrove Court, used for candidate interviews and confidential HR meetings. Walk through the booking panel outside the door, the do-not-disturb light, and the rule that laptops and notes must not be left inside between sessions. Blinds stay down during interviews. The room locks automatically on exit, so warn them not to prop the door. They will need the door code for access, which is set out below.

badge for fafop-fajof: bdg-Z-47

## Further reading

The Quillbase SDKs for Dart and Lua are not at parity. Batch writes, offline sync, and the hook API exist only in Dart; Lua lags by roughly two releases. Do not assume identical behavior across clients when publishing a plugin. The parity matrix, tracked per release, is maintained on the internal page below.

wiki page, tahaf-tajog: https://jira.ordindyn.corp/pipeline